What is a function of a harrow?

A harrow is a farming implement used to prepare soil for planting by breaking up and leveling the ground. Its primary function is to refine the soil structure, incorporating crop residues and promoting seedbed preparation. Harrows can also help control weeds and improve soil aeration and moisture retention, contributing to better crop yields. Overall, they play a crucial role in the tillage process within agricultural practices.
